Question
A grocer had the same number of starfruits, persimmons and peaches at first. After 40 peaches, some starfruits and persimmons were set aside, there were 184 fruits left. There were five times as many starfruits as persimmons left. The number of peaches left was 36 less than the number of starfruits. How many persimmons were set aside?
